Can you take Jamaican black castor oil orally?

When consumed by mouth, castor oil is broken down in the small intestine, releasing ricinoleic acid, the main fatty acid in castor oil. The ricinoleic acid is then absorbed by the intestine, stimulating a strong laxative effect ( 2 ). In fact, several studies have shown that castor oil can relieve constipation.

Are all castor oil the same?

“…but aren’t all castor oils the same?” No, not at all! Castor oil (CAS number 8001-79-4) is a colorless to very pale yellow liquid with mild or no odor or taste. The main composition of castor oil is Ricinoleic acid. This is important because Ricinoleic acid is anti-inflammatory.

Can I use castor oil for hair growth?

As castor oil gains popularity in the natural beauty world, proponents suggest that the use of oil can dramatically increase the rate of hair growth. Some even claim that monthly application of the oil can boost hair growth by up to five times the usual rate. There’s currently no scientific evidence to show that castor oil can promote hair growth.
